About The Position

Zantech is a dynamic Woman Owned Small Business focused on providing complex, mission-focused solutions. They are seeking a talented Alternate Site Manager for an On-site role at Fort Lee, VA, to contribute to their upcoming Information Technology Support Services project. The Alternate Site Manager acts for the contractor in all matters when the primary Site Manager is absent, holding the same authority and qualification requirements. This individual must be available to meet with Government representatives within 30 minutes during normal duty hours. In the absence of the Site Manager, the Alternate serves as the single point of contact for all daily contract operations for the IT Support Services requirement at Fort Lee, Virginia, possessing full authority to act on all contract matters relating to daily operations and ensuring uninterrupted performance of all tasks.

Requirements

  • 5 years minimum as Site Manager or equivalent leadership role within the past 10 years
  • Same full contract authority as Site Manager when acting in that capacity including: Full contract authority and decision-making capability for daily operations
  • Quality Control Plan (QCP) development, implementation, and maintenance
  • Workforce management across a multi-discipline IT support team of 40+ personnel
  • Coordination with Government COR on all contractual and technical matters
  • Ability to meet with Government representatives within 30 minutes during duty hours (0700-1700 M-F)
  • Available within 2 hours after normal duty hours for emergencies
  • Weekly, monthly, and quarterly reporting to Government COR
  • Subcontractor oversight and management
  • Compliance with DoD 8570.01-M Information Assurance Training, Certification, and Workforce Management
  • Workforce oversight and day-to-day coordination with the Government COR
  • Bachelor's degree in Computer Science, Information Systems, or related field of study; OR Five (5) years of related experience in lieu of degree
  • IAT Level II baseline certification IAW DoD 8570.01-M (e.g., CompTIA Security+ CE, SSCP, CCNA Security)
  • Computing Environment (CE) certification appropriate to supported operating systems
  • DoD IA Cyber Awareness Training (completed prior to network access; renewed annually)
  • AT Level I Antiterrorism Training (within 30 days of start)
  • OPSEC Level I Training (within 30 days of start; annual refresh)
  • US Citizenship and the ability to maintain an Active Secret or higher clearance, per contract requirements.

Responsibilities

  • Serve as the single on-site point of contact between the Government and all contractor personnel assigned to this contract
  • Maintain full authority to act for the contractor on all contract matters relating to daily operations
  • Develop and submit the Quality Control Plan (QCP) to the COR within 10 days of contract start; maintain and update throughout performance
  • Submit Weekly Progress Reports NLT the 3rd day of the following week
  • Submit Monthly Summary Reports (MSR) NLT the 5th working day of each month, to include employee strength report, by-name roster, and training summary
  • Prepare for, support, and actively participate in quarterly In-Process Reviews (IPRs)
  • Report issues or potential issues to the COR within 2 working hours of identification; follow up with written report within 2 days
  • Ensure all contractor personnel maintain required security clearances, certifications, and training currency throughout performance
  • Manage subcontractor performance to ensure seamless integration with the Government
  • Ensure contractor workspace signage is submitted for COR approval within 10 days of award
  • Develop and maintain Phase-Out Plan, submitted within 14 days of contract start and updated NLT 45 days prior to expiration
  • Submit CAC Log within 30 days of award; update within 5 days of any personnel changes
